5 Common Tractor Repairs

1. Blade Sharpening

For lawn and garden use, a key aspect of your tractor is its blades, and sharpening them is one of the most common tractor repair services. For a small garden tractor with a single blade, you can remove it and sharpen it with a file. A tractor maintenance service can help with larger equipment. 

2. Fuel System Repairs

If your tractor’s engine performance has decreased, a faulty fuel system could be the cause. Problems with the components that transport fuel to the engine can lead to low fuel pressure, which will affect the tractor’s overall functionality. A professional will test and inspect the fuel system and conduct necessary tractor repairs to get it back to proper working condition. 

3. Electrical System Maintenance

Tractor repairs Granville OHWhen tractor repair is needed due to electrical trouble, it's best to start with the battery. Make sure the battery has a charge and the posts and cables are free of deposits. If the battery isn’t the problem, call a professional for repairs.  

4. Spark Plug Replacement

Spark plugs are simple devices that make operating your vehicle difficult when they go bad. If you're experiencing hard starts, inefficient fuel consumption, or poor engine performance, spark plug replacement may be necessary. 

5. Carburetor Services

The carburetor blends air and fuel to provide a combustible mixture for the engine cylinder, so you need to keep it well maintained. If a clogged carburetor has your tractor running roughly, have it cleaned or rebuilt. If a carburetor is damaged or severely corroded, you'll have to call a tractor repair professional for a replacement.
